More Than Half of 55,000 Spots Filled for the Atlanta Journal-Constitution Peachtree Road Race, Registration Ends April 30th
Thursday, April 10th, 2025
Registration for the 56th Running of the Atlanta Journal-Constitution Peachtree Road Race is underway, and with just over a week since opening, more than 30,000 runners have already registered for Atlanta’s most celebrated Fourth of July tradition.
With only 55,000 total entries available and registration numbers already outpacing previous years, race organizers anticipate reaching capacity well before the April 30 deadline. Those hoping to be a part of the world’s largest 10K are encouraged to become an Atlanta Track Club member to guarantee their spot. Non-members must enter the lottery for a chance to participate, with no guaranteed entry.
“The Peachtree is a rite of passage for Atlanta every summer,” said Rich Kenah, CEO of Atlanta Track Club and race director of the Peachtree. “The excitement we’re seeing in this early wave of registrations confirms how much this tradition continues to mean to the community. But it also means that spots are going quickly. If you plan to join us at the start line on July 4, now is the time to register.”
Registration is only available to the public through April 30. Atlanta Track Club members receive guaranteed entry at the lowest price of $55 and preferred start wave placement A-M. Non-members must enter the lottery for a chance to participate at $65, with all lottery entrants having an equal chance of selection. Lottery results will be announced the week of May 5. Runners may also bypass the lottery by registering for the Peachtree with a Purpose: Kilometer Kids Charity Waves, which offer guaranteed entry in early start waves in exchange for a charitable donation supporting Atlanta Track Club’s free youth running program. Registration for the charity waves will be available after the April 30 deadline.
As excitement for the race builds, volunteer registration officially opens today, Wednesday, April 10, offering more than 3,000 opportunities, including race participant-friendly positions, to support the Peachtree experience across race weekend events.
Volunteers are needed for roles including:
- Greeters and race number pickup at the Peachtree Health & Fitness Expo presented by Publix
- On-course support and medal distribution for the Chick-fil-A Peachtree Junior
- Hydration station assistance, finish line services
- Race participant-friendly roles, including pre-race and post-race shifts that allow runners to volunteer and take part in the event
“An event of this scale simply couldn’t happen without the energy, enthusiasm and dedication of thousands of volunteers,” said Kenah. “Being a Peachtree volunteer is an incredible way to participate in this city-wide celebration and help bring the race to life.”

The 56th Running of the AJC Peachtree Road Race will take place on Thursday, July 4, with events throughout race week—including the Peachtree Health & Fitness Expo presented by Publix at Lenox Square on July 2–3, and the Chick-fil-A Peachtree Junior on the morning of July 3. Race day festivities culminate with a new post-race celebration in Piedmont Park’s Meadow, including SweetWater Brewing beer gardens, music and more.
